Re: [pgbr-geral] missing chunk number 0 for toast value 343342964 in pg_toast_2619

2016-10-03 Por tôpico Sebastian Webber
Em 3 de outubro de 2016 14:39, Zan  escreveu:

> Boa tarde a todos.
>
> Versão: PostgreSQL 9.3.4 on x86_64-unknown-linux-gnu, compiled by gcc
> (Ubuntu/Linaro 4.6.3-1ubuntu5) 4.6.3, 64-bit
>
> Nosso BD não está mais listando algumas tabelas internas do sistema, por
> exemplo, ao fazer select * from pg_class aparece a seguinte mensagem:
> missing chunk number 0 for toast value 343342964 in pg_toast_2619
>
> Alguém pode me dar alguma orientação sobre como resolver este problema?
>


Você tem algum backup recente do banco? esse é o jeito mais fácil de
resolver isso: recriar o cluster (com o initdb, claro) e restaurar os dados
nele.

Caso você não tenha, faça backup do diretório de dados e dos tablespaces
ANTES de fazer qualquer procedimento.

Sugestão que eu dou antes de começar é, apesar do erro, subir o banco em
single e tentar reindexar o catalogo e tentar fazer backup da base com
problemas. uma vez com o backup, faça o que sugeri antes.

Agora, caso você faça isso e não tenha efeito: eu sugiro que identifique
quais são as tabelas e linhas corrompidas pra pensarmos num plano de ação.

PS: corrupção de dados não é uma coisa comum. alguma idéia do que causou
isso?





-- 
Sebastian Webber
http://swebber.me
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] PostgreSQL 9.5.4 + Windows 10

2016-10-03 Por tôpico sistemas

>Nao creio que seja um problema de limite de conexoes, ate porque sao poucas 
>conexoes que eh usado pelo sistema, tipo < 20.
>Agora vi um POST falando sobre a possibilidade de deixar o "Secondary Logon" 
>do windows ativado como automatic.  Isso em um outro caso semelhante de 
>suposta suspensao do postgresql, de forma que >ao habilitar o "problema" foi 
>resolvido, ao termino dos testes deixo o comentario aqui. 


Só acrescentando quanto ao limite de conexões, não é contado só conexões com 
bancos de dados, mas toda conexão, por exemplo, as vezes deixamos a maquina com 
windows como servidor tanto de dados como de arquivos, é ai que o sistema 
operacional faz o gargalo.

So pra complementar veja esse link: 
http://answers.microsoft.com/pt-br/windows/forum/windows_7-networking/limite-conex%C3%B5es-windows-7/5c628d95-ae5a-4ce9-b422-20065c5a012d

Veja que tem algumas dicas de como liberar esses limites

https://forum.baboo.com.br/index.php?/topic/687303-acabando-com-limite-de-10-conex%C3%B5es-no-windows-7/


Marcelo
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] missing chunk number 0 for toast value 343342964 in pg_toast_2619

2016-10-03 Por tôpico Michel Luiz Milezzi
>
> Infelizmente o problema está ocorrendo com outras tabelas, como por
> exemplo information_schema.role_table_grants.
>
> Na verdade o problema ocorre com mais de uma tabela interna porém a
> mensagem de erro é sempre a mesma.


O fato da corrupção não ser um "fato isolado" pode indicar um problema de
hardware. Sugiro você disparar um fsck ou outro utilitário de verificação
de disco da sua preferência. Importante: não dispare a verificação se a
partição em questão estiver montada, caso contrário a corrupção pode ser
agravada.
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] missing chunk number 0 for toast value 343342964 in pg_toast_2619

2016-10-03 Por tôpico Zan

On 03/10/2016 15:06, ANDRESSA ARAUJO wrote:

Boa tarde,

Provavelmente essa tabela pg_class está com linhas corrompidas.

Encontrei esse blog que talvez ajude:
_http://helkmut.blogspot.com.br/2011/07/postgresql-corrigindo-tabela-corrompida.html_


Andressa, obrigado pela resposta.
Infelizmente o problema está ocorrendo com outras tabelas, como por 
exemplo information_schema.role_table_grants.


Na verdade o problema ocorre com mais de uma tabela interna porém a 
mensagem de erro é sempre a mesma.



___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] missing chunk number 0 for toast value 343342964 in pg_toast_2619

2016-10-03 Por tôpico ANDRESSA ARAUJO
Boa tarde,

Provavelmente essa tabela pg_class está com linhas corrompidas.

Encontrei esse blog que talvez ajude:
*http://helkmut.blogspot.com.br/2011/07/postgresql-corrigindo-tabela-corrompida.html
*


Em 3 de outubro de 2016 14:39, Zan  escreveu:

> Boa tarde a todos.
>
> Versão: PostgreSQL 9.3.4 on x86_64-unknown-linux-gnu, compiled by gcc
> (Ubuntu/Linaro 4.6.3-1ubuntu5) 4.6.3, 64-bit
>
> Nosso BD não está mais listando algumas tabelas internas do sistema, por
> exemplo, ao fazer select * from pg_class aparece a seguinte mensagem:
> missing chunk number 0 for toast value 343342964 in pg_toast_2619
>
> Alguém pode me dar alguma orientação sobre como resolver este problema?
>
> Obrigado.
>
> ___
> pgbr-geral mailing list
> pgbr-geral@listas.postgresql.org.br
> https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ral




-- 
Att,

Andressa A de Mesquita.
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] PostgreSQL 9.5.4 + Windows 10

2016-10-03 Por tôpico Guimarães Faria Corcete DUTRA , Leandro
2016-10-03 14:59 GMT-03:00 Emanuel Araújo :
>> O WindowXP tem uma limitação de conexões de usuário quando se usa ele como
>> servidor ...
>
> Nao creio que seja um problema de limite de conexoes, ate porque sao poucas
> conexoes que eh usado pelo sistema, tipo < 20.

No MS-WNT Workstation, o limite era dez.


-- 
skype:leandro.gfc.dutra?chat  Yahoo!: ymsgr:sendIM?lgcdutra
+55 (61) 3546 7191  gTalk: xmpp:leand...@jabber.org
+55 (61) 9302 2691ICQ/AIM: aim:GoIM?screenname=61287803
BRAZIL GMT−3  MSN: msnim:chat?contact=lean...@dutra.fastmail.fm
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] PostgreSQL 9.5.4 + Windows 10

2016-10-03 Por tôpico Emanuel Araújo
> O WindowXP tem uma limitação de conexões de usuário quando se usa ele
como servidor ...

Nao creio que seja um problema de limite de conexoes, ate porque sao poucas
conexoes que eh usado pelo sistema, tipo < 20.
Agora vi um POST falando sobre a possibilidade de deixar o "Secondary
Logon" do windows ativado como automatic.  Isso em um outro caso semelhante
de suposta suspensao do postgresql, de forma que ao habilitar o "problema"
foi resolvido, ao termino dos testes deixo o comentario aqui.


-- 


*Atenciosamente,Emanuel Araújo*
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

[pgbr-geral] missing chunk number 0 for toast value 343342964 in pg_toast_2619

2016-10-03 Por tôpico Zan

Boa tarde a todos.

Versão: PostgreSQL 9.3.4 on x86_64-unknown-linux-gnu, compiled by gcc 
(Ubuntu/Linaro 4.6.3-1ubuntu5) 4.6.3, 64-bit


Nosso BD não está mais listando algumas tabelas internas do sistema, por 
exemplo, ao fazer select * from pg_class aparece a seguinte mensagem: 
missing chunk number 0 for toast value 343342964 in pg_toast_2619


Alguém pode me dar alguma orientação sobre como resolver este problema?

Obrigado.

___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] PostgreSQL 9.5.4 + Windows 10

2016-10-03 Por tôpico sistemas
>Nao temos parametrizacao, o postgresql roda usando o padrao, ate porque para o 
>nosso sistema nao ha uma demanda que precise ser feito algum tipo de ajuste 
>inicialmente e nessa ultima versao ele >vem setado com uma configuracao 
>melhorada.

>Vou continuar a analise e acompanhamento desse ambiente.  Quem tiver outras 
>informacoes agradeco ja o compartilhamento.

>Obrigado Srs.

-- 
>Atenciosamente,
>Emanuel Araújo


O WindowXP tem uma limitação de conexões de usuário quando se usa ele como 
servidor, e isso não é limite do banco mas sim do sistema operacional por nao 
ser um Windows Server, é uma jogada MS pra vc adquirir o Windows Server e no 
fundo faz sentido ...

Não li nada a respeito sobre isso no Windows 10, mas acho que pode ser uma 
limitação do sistema e não algum problema com postgres.
Nesse caso não terá como fugir de um Windows Server ou Linux.

Verifique na Web se o Windows10 tem essa limitação, eu acho bem provavel.


Marcelo Silva

___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] PostgreSQL 9.5.4 + Windows 10

2016-10-03 Por tôpico Emanuel Araújo
> Percebemos que tinha uma DLL da Caixa Econômica Federal que provocava o
problema. O nome dela é: gbiehcef.dll
> Verifique se no seu caso não está acontecendo isso.

 Irei verificar.  Obrigado.

> vocês têm feito alguma parametrização posterior à instalação padrão do
Postgres?

Nao temos parametrizacao, o postgresql roda usando o padrao, ate porque
para o nosso sistema nao ha uma demanda que precise ser feito algum tipo de
ajuste inicialmente e nessa ultima versao ele vem setado com uma
configuracao melhorada.

Vou continuar a analise e acompanhamento desse ambiente.  Quem tiver outras
informacoes agradeco ja o compartilhamento.

Obrigado Srs.



-- 


*Atenciosamente,Emanuel Araújo*
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] Obter menor valor de coluna - Dúvida sobre index only scan em tabela/índice grande

2016-10-03 Por tôpico Everton Luís Berz
Obrigado Matheus

foi feito um pg_repack na tabela (que consequentemente recria o índice) e
agora baixou para 30 milisegundos.

Só para eu entender, o quê seria o que você chama de inchaço? Não há um
jeito do PostgreSQL gerenciar melhor isso automaticamente?

--
Everton
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] PostgreSQL 9.5.4 + Windows 10

2016-10-03 Por tôpico Alexsandro Haag

Em 03/10/2016 11:37, Emanuel Araújo escreveu:


Srs.

Passsamos a usar ultimamente em nossos clientes a versao PostgreSQL 
9.5.4 + Windows 10, e constantemente vem ocorrendo "travamento" do 
postgresql logo apos o inicio do servidor, falo travamento mas na 
verdade nao sei ao certo o que esta ocorrendo.  O ambiente instalado 
eh 64bits, ja desativamos antivirus, firewall e mesmo assim essa 
situacao ocorre com frequencia (poderia haver algum tipo de 
interferencia).  O desligamento da maquina eh realizado de forma 
correta (Iniciar/Desligar).


Notamos que ao usar as versoes mais antigas do windows como 7, o 
postgresql se comporta melhor, "travando" menos.  O "travamento" 
ocorre de forma que nao conseguimos realizar conexoes com o banco, mas 
se mostra como ativo em "services".


Emanuel,
  vocês têm feito alguma parametrização posterior à instalação padrão 
do Postgres?


Pergunto porque ele pode não estar corretamente dimensionado para a 
demanda de requisições e acessos.


Seria interessante passar mais detalhes do ambiente e as parametrizações 
já realizadas.


Alex
___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Re: [pgbr-geral] PostgreSQL 9.5.4 + Windows 10

2016-10-03 Por tôpico marco
Em um cliente meu tenho a mesma versão do PG instalada no Windows Server 
2012 R2.
Quase que diariamente uma das tarefas do PG apareciam como Suspensa o 
que impedia a conexão com o banco, só resolvendo após reiniciar o servidor.
Percebemos que tinha uma DLL da Caixa Econômica Federal que provocava o 
problema. O nome dela é: gbiehcef.dll


Verifique se no seu caso não está acontecendo isso.

Marco Antonio
Tactor Software


Em 03/10/2016 11:37, Emanuel Araújo escreveu:

Srs.

Passsamos a usar ultimamente em nossos clientes a versao PostgreSQL 
9.5.4 + Windows 10, e constantemente vem ocorrendo "travamento" do 
postgresql logo apos o inicio do servidor, falo travamento mas na 
verdade nao sei ao certo o que esta ocorrendo.  O ambiente instalado 
eh 64bits, ja desativamos antivirus, firewall e mesmo assim essa 
situacao ocorre com frequencia (poderia haver algum tipo de 
interferencia).  O desligamento da maquina eh realizado de forma 
correta (Iniciar/Desligar).


Notamos que ao usar as versoes mais antigas do windows como 7, o 
postgresql se comporta melhor, "travando" menos.  O "travamento" 
ocorre de forma que nao conseguimos realizar conexoes com o banco, mas 
se mostra como ativo em "services".


Como acoes da minha equipe de suporte, os mesmos precisam parar/matar 
todos os processos do PostgreSQL (Normalmente pelo monitor de 
recursos) e subir novamente, as vezes reiniciando o computador 
novamente normaliza tambem.  No Log do postgresql nao apresenta nada 
que possa estar causando esse problema.


Alguem ja passou por essa situacao ou algo parecido? Caso sim, quais 
acoes foram realizadas para resolver ou diminuir o problema.


Por gentileza, lembrar que meu problema nao tem nesse momento a opcao 
de mudar de windows para linux.


--
*Atenciosamente,

Emanuel Araújo*
*/
/*


___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ral


___
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ral